Tracking Water Use with Precision and Purpose

Water scarcity is one of agriculture’s most urgent challenges. Over irrigation increases costs and depletes resources, while under irrigation threatens yield and crop health. CYOL allows farms to track irrigation activities in real time, linking water usage directly to fields, crops and growth stages.

This visibility helps farmers optimize irrigation schedules, identify inefficiencies and respond quickly to changing weather conditions. Over time, water data becomes a strategic asset supporting conservation goals, regulatory reporting and long term resilience in water stressed regions.

Smarter Input Management for Lower Impact

Fertilizers, pesticides and other inputs are essential for productivity, but excessive or poorly timed application can harm both the environment and profitability. CYOL enables detailed tracking of input usage across the farm, providing clarity on what is applied, where, when and why.

With this data, farms can analyse input efficiency, reduce waste and align application strategies with crop needs. The result is lower environmental impact without compromising yields. Sustainability becomes an outcome of precision rather than restriction.

Making Emissions Visible at the Farm Level

One of the most complex aspects of agricultural sustainability is emissions tracking. Fuel use, fertilizer application and farm operations all contribute to greenhouse gas emissions, yet many farms lack the tools to quantify their impact. CYOL helps bridge this gap by connecting operational data to emissions indicators.

By linking daily activities to measurable emissions metrics, CYOL provides farms with a realistic understanding of their carbon footprint. This visibility supports participation in sustainability programs, carbon initiatives and climate smart agriculture strategies—turning compliance into opportunity.
